Essie Nothing Else Metals


Next up in the Essie Mirror Metallics is Nothing Else Metals, a pale lavender foil. Again swatch photos are shown two coats over one coat of Essie Grow Stronger with no top coat, unless stated. The formula was the same on this one as Blue Rhapsody, you can see the Blue Rhapsody post here. Slightly temperamental in application but second coat came out good. Very pretty, very light lavender color.




I decided to add and accent nail and stamp over Nothing Else Metals with the silver from this collection, No Place Like Chrome. I used Mash-40 image plate. I was a little disappointed that the silver and lavender were so similar in color, but after a while I decided I kind of like the subtle stamp effect. However, I think I will have to do a side by side of all five colors when I'm done so you can more accurately see the color differences. These photos are with one coat of Seche Vite over the stamp.

Essie Blue Rhapsody


Yesterday I asked which of my newest polish additions you wanted to see first and it seems like the new Essie Metallic polishes were the most wanted. So here's the first one, Blue Rhapsody, an icy blue foil. All swatch photos are shown two coats over one coat of Essie Grow Stronger (upcoming review of this nail treatment in a few days) with no top coat.


I was a little worried when the first coat on the first nail came out REALLY streaky and any attempt to correct it only made it worse. On the next nail I applied a thicker coat to start with and didn't seem to have the streak problem. On my thumb and middle finger I realized that this polish dries fast and you can't dally in your application. Once I figured these things out the rest of the application and the second coat were just fine.



This is definitely one you'll want to use some underwear for, maybe a ridge-filler if you have it. I noticed it shows all the flaws in my nail underneath, but that it pretty common for metallic polish.



Now how many of you saw these online or on the shelf and though what I did..."Metallic...hmm, I wonder if they stamp? " Well, I had huge hopes that they would, and I can't speak for the other colors yet but...this one does. Woo Hoo!!!
With top coat



I re-did my ring finger nail as an accent nail (Essie Grow Stronger - 1 coat, unnamed Cosmetic Arts pink creme - 2 coats and with one coat of Seche Vite). I used one of my new MASH stamp plates (Mash-49) for the star pattern.
